Cancer Waiting Times Patient Tracker, Band 3

Cancer Waiting Times Patient Tracker, Band 3


Gloucestershire

Job summary

We are looking for a pro-active, motivated individual to work within our dedicated admin team who support the Trust delivering Cancer wait targets.

These are exciting roles focusing on expediting patients through the pathway from their first appointment to treatment. Duties will include liaising with Central booking office and specialties to accurately record progress.

Applicants must have excellent communication, good working knowledge of MS software, data collection skills and be flexible in their approach.

Main duties of the job

The post holder will be responsible for tracking cancer patients in line with national cancer targets and will facilitate data collection for suspected/ diagnosed cancer patients, entering the information onto appropriate database(s). The post includes providing administration support for the MDT Co-ordinators and data collection for the National Cancer Audits. This post is essential to providing high quality information and ensuring patient's progress effectively on the cancer pathway.
